“CHARACTERS IN CINEMA 4D COURSE 2 LESSON 4 Simulations (rigid and soft objects) In this lesson we'll create simulations, which are either rigid or soft. Let's start. I will use a sphere and a cube for this exercise. We will start with the sphere. We will activate the segments and create a plane. This plane will serve as a floor for the object to land on. Now I will make the plane editable with the C key or the upper left icon. I will also add segments to the sphere, maybe 22, and I make it editable. I right-click and I see the tags we can use.
